This Chapter is an excerpt from Chapter 6 of the Yellow Emperor's Classic of Internal Medicine, specifically focusing on longevity, mortality, and the balance of yin and yang in the body. It details diagnostic methods involving the observation of physical characteristics and symptoms to determine the nature of illness. The text then explains acupuncture techniques for treating various ailments based on the location and type of imbalance (yin or yang), and it offers detailed instructions for preparing and using medicated compresses. Finally, it explores the relationship between physical form, qi, and lifespan prediction.
